CAS 959236-96-5
:8-fluoroquinazoline-2,4(1H,3H)-dione
Description:
8-Fluoroquinazoline-2,4(1H,3H)-dione is a synthetic organic compound characterized by its quinazoline core structure, which is a bicyclic compound containing a benzene ring fused to a pyrimidine ring. The presence of a fluorine atom at the 8-position of the quinazoline structure contributes to its unique chemical properties, potentially enhancing its biological activity and lipophilicity. The compound features two carbonyl groups (diones) at the 2 and 4 positions, which can participate in various chemical reactions, including nucleophilic attacks and hydrogen bonding. This compound is of interest in medicinal chemistry due to its potential applications in drug development, particularly in targeting specific biological pathways. Its molecular structure allows for interactions with various biological targets, making it a candidate for further research in pharmacology. Additionally, the compound's stability and reactivity can be influenced by the presence of the fluorine atom, which can affect its solubility and overall bioavailability.
